WebJan 14, 2024 · Shoulder bursitis is the inflammation of the shoulder bursae, which are fluid-filled sacs found within the skeletal system. They provide a cushion between the bones and connective tissues of the body, and allow the tendons to move freely and glide without friction when arm movement occurs. WebJul 6, 2024 · A bursa is a small, fluid-filled sac that acts as a cushion between bones, tendons, and muscles near joints. Bursitis often occurs in the shoulder when the rotator cuff tendons rub against the shoulder blade. This rubbing can irritate the bursa and cause it to become inflamed. WebShoulder Bursitis. Shoulder. Bursa are sac-like structures located where there may be friction in the body — like between tendons and bones. When there is too much friction, the bursa become irritated and inflamed leading to bursitis.
